What termites we actually have

Texas A&M AgriLife's own guidance is that subterranean termites decrease from the Gulf Coast inland, and are noticed less often in the High Plains and far West Texas. Two of the three species people most fear do not occur here at all.

Arid-land subterranean termite

Reticulitermes tibialis — the subterranean species that actually lives out here, adapted to deserts and arid locations with hard-packed or alkaline soil. It is a real structural pest and it is the one worth inspecting for. It is also documented as doing relatively little damage to structures compared with its eastern cousins.

Desert termite

Gnathamitermes tubiformans — abundant here, and not a structural pest. It eats dead grass and plant material. It throws up carton sheeting on lawns after summer storms, which is what most "I think I have termites" photographs actually show. AgriLife also notes its abundance tracks range condition and early spring rainfall, so it comes and goes.

Formosan termite — not here

Detected in around thirty Texas counties, primarily the greater Houston-Galveston area and Beaumont-Port Arthur. There are no West Texas records. If a company is talking to you about Formosan termites in Gaines County, they are reading from a script written for somewhere else.

Drywood termite — not here

A coastal-counties problem with scattered spots into south-central Texas. Not a Permian Basin pest. Worth knowing because drywood and subterranean termites need completely different treatments, and being sold the wrong one is expensive.

Why soil decides most of it

This is the part almost nobody in this market writes about, and it is the single most defensible thing a termite company can talk about.

The ground across this service area changes considerably town to town. Around Seminole, Seagraves, Andrews and much of West Texas it is sandy soil, caliche, and areas with a mix of clay. Some properties sit on very loose sand. Others have extremely hard caliche layers a spade will not go through. New construction and developed property frequently has disturbed or imported fill packed around the foundation, which behaves differently again from the native ground three feet away.

From a termite standpoint that matters because moisture retention, drainage, soil movement and how the structure meets the soil all affect both whether termites are active and how a treatment has to be applied. A continuous treated zone means something different in loose sand than it does through caliche. Where the fill line sits changes where you drill.

It also means the honest answer to "do I need termite treatment" is genuinely property-specific. Two houses on the same street, one on native caliche and one on imported fill, are not the same risk.

How the work is done

Inspection first, always. Foundation type, construction, linear footage, access, soil, moisture, conducive conditions, and where any activity actually is. The quote comes after that, because every one of those changes the number.

Liquid barrier — Termidor HE and Termidor SC. The conventional approach for most slab work here: establishing a treated zone in the soil around and beneath the structure, which on a slab means drilling and injecting through the slab, porches, patios, fireplaces and adjacent sidewalks where they abut the foundation. Termidor is non-repellent, which is the point — termites move through the treated zone rather than avoiding it.

Trelona bait systems. In-ground stations around the structure, monitored and maintained. This suits properties where trenching and drilling is impractical, where construction makes a continuous barrier hard to achieve, or where an owner would rather have ongoing monitoring than a single event. It works more slowly by design, because the colony has to find the material and share it.

Bora-Care. A borate applied to bare wood framing — most useful during construction or where framing is accessible, treating the wood itself rather than the soil. Texas rules allow borate treatment of primary wood framing as an alternative in pre-construction work, applied per label to at least two feet above slab contact.

New-construction pre-treats. Texas is specific about these under 4 TAC §7.173: a continuous horizontal and vertical barrier for a full treatment, a required return visit after the slab is poured and piers are placed to complete the vertical barrier, and final application within 30 days of landscaping completion or one year from construction completion, whichever is earlier. Partial treatments are permitted where construction physically prevents a complete one — but only with a signed attestation from the property owner, treated areas documented on amended diagrams, and copies to the owner within seven days. Records are kept two years.

The warranty, stated plainly

A 12-month re-treatment warranty on qualifying termite treatments. Re-treatment of the affected area if active termites are found in a covered area during the warranty period.

What it does not cover. Existing termite damage, repairs to the structure, and damage caused by future termite activity. Coverage is subject to the conditions of the original termite treatment agreement and to the property remaining reasonably unchanged from the time of treatment.

After the first year, termite protection can be renewed annually, which includes an inspection and continued re-treatment coverage.

What to ask any termite company, including this one

  • Which species do you think this is, and how do you know? "Termites" is not an answer in a region where one of the common species does not eat wood.
  • Are you licensed in the termite control category specifically? A Texas pest control licence does not authorise termite work — they are separate categories. Ours is TPCL 0976265 and it covers both.
  • What is the linear footage, and how did you measure it? It is the main driver of the price.
  • Liquid or bait, and why this one for my house? If the answer is the same for every property, it was not a decision.
  • What exactly does the warranty cover — re-treatment, or damage? Get it in writing either way.
  • What am I being given before treatment? Texas requires a written estimate carrying the business licence number, a diagram with perimeter measurements, product labels and concentrations, complete warranty details and a consumer information sheet before treatment begins.

What termite evidence actually looks like

Most people never see a termite. What they see is one of these, and knowing the difference saves everybody a trip.

Mud tubes. Pencil-width earthen tubes running up a foundation wall, a pier or the inside of a crawlspace. Subterranean termites build them to keep moisture around themselves while they travel between soil and wood. An intact tube with live insects inside is active evidence. An old dry tube on its own tells you there was activity, not that there is now.

Swarmers and discarded wings. Winged reproductives leaving a colony, usually in spring here. Small piles of identical shed wings on a windowsill or near a light are one of the more reliable indicators. Worth distinguishing from flying ants — termite wings are equal in length, ant wings are not, and a termite has a straight waist where an ant has a pinched one.

Hollow-sounding or blistered wood. Termites eat wood from the inside, following the grain, so a surface can look sound and give under a screwdriver. Trim, door frames and skirting near the slab are the usual places to check.

Carton sheeting on a lawn. Desert termite, not a structural problem. Covered above, and worth repeating because it produces more unnecessary quotes than anything else here.

Conducive conditions — what invites them

Termites need moisture and a route. Most of what makes a property attractive is fixable without a treatment at all:

  • Soil or mulch piled against the siding, above the slab line
  • Wood-to-ground contact — fence posts, deck supports, trim, stored lumber
  • Leaking hose bibs, condensate lines and irrigation running against the foundation
  • Poor drainage holding water at the perimeter after rain
  • Firewood or lumber stacked against the wall — the same mistake that feeds a scorpion problem
  • Blocked weep holes and covered vents on pier-and-beam construction

Texas requires those conditions to be documented on the diagram a customer receives before treatment, which is a rule worth knowing exists.

Foundation type changes the whole job

Every type of home in this area presents different termite challenges, and the treatment follows the construction rather than a standard procedure.

Slab-on-grade — the majority of newer construction here. Risk concentrates at plumbing penetrations, expansion joints and the foundation perimeter. A full liquid treatment means drilling and injecting through the slab and through attached patios, porches, fireplaces and adjacent sidewalks, because a barrier with a gap in it is not a barrier.

Pier-and-beam — common in the older parts of town. Crawlspace moisture, accessible framing and rodent activity underneath all come together. The advantage is that you can actually inspect and treat what you can see; the disadvantage is that moisture control matters as much as the treatment does.

Manufactured and mobile homes — their own set of problems underneath, especially around skirting, utility penetrations, moisture and where the structure meets the ground. Frequently overlooked entirely, and a large part of the housing stock across Gaines County and the smaller towns.

New construction — where a pre-treat belongs, and where imported fill around the foundation behaves differently from the native ground next to it.

That is why the inspection looks at how a house was built, its age, its foundation and what is happening around and underneath it before anybody recommends anything.

When you probably do not need us

A termite page that only argues for treatment is a sales page. Here is the other half, which is just as true:

Carton sheeting on the lawn after a storm. Desert termite. Not structural. Nothing to buy. It comes and goes with rainfall and range condition, and it will most likely disappear on its own.

Winged insects around a light in spring, with unequal wings and a pinched waist. Flying ants, not termites. Worth treating if the ants are a problem in their own right, but it is a general pest job rather than a termite job and should be priced as one.

One old, dry mud tube with nothing in it. Evidence of previous activity. That is worth a proper look to establish whether anything is live, but previous activity on its own is not an active infestation and should not be quoted as one.

A newer home with a documented pre-treat and no evidence. Worth an inspection on a sensible interval. Not worth a full treatment because somebody knocked on the door.

The honest position on West Texas termite risk is that it is real, lower than most of the state, and highly property-specific. If the inspection says you do not need anything, that is what you will be told — and the inspection is where the value is either way.

There is a reasonable middle option people rarely get offered, too. On a property with no current activity but genuinely conducive conditions — poor drainage at the perimeter, wood in ground contact, soil above the slab line — the right answer is often to fix the conditions and re-inspect on a sensible interval rather than to treat. That costs you almost nothing and it removes the reason the problem would have started. Ask for it.

Termite questions

Do we even get termites in West Texas?

Yes, but less than most people assume, and not the species the internet warns about. Texas A&M AgriLife notes that subterranean termites decrease from the Gulf Coast inland and are noticed less often in the High Plains and far West Texas. Formosan termites are concentrated around Houston-Galveston and Beaumont-Port Arthur and have no West Texas records. Drywood termites are a coastal and south-central problem. What we actually have here is the arid-land subterranean termite and the desert termite.

What is the white sheeting on my lawn after a storm?

Almost always desert termite, Gnathamitermes tubiformans — one of the most common species in western Texas, New Mexico and Arizona. It eats dead grass and plant material, not structures, and it throws up carton sheeting on turf after summer rain. It looks alarming and it is not a structural problem. If somebody quotes you a full treatment off a photograph of lawn sheeting, get a second opinion.

Liquid barrier or bait system — which do I need?

It depends on the structure and the situation rather than on which one we prefer. A liquid treatment with Termidor establishes a continuous treated zone in the soil around and under the structure and suits most conventional slab work here. A Trelona bait system suits properties where drilling and trenching is impractical, where the construction makes a continuous barrier hard to achieve, or where an owner wants ongoing monitoring rather than a single treatment. Sometimes the answer is both, in different areas.

Do you do pre-treats for new construction?

Yes. Texas rules on pre-construction treatment are specific: 4 TAC §7.173 requires a continuous horizontal and vertical pesticide barrier for a full treatment, a return visit after the slab is poured and piers are placed to complete the vertical barrier, and final application within 30 days of landscaping completion or one year from construction completion, whichever comes first. Partial treatments are allowed where construction physically prevents a complete one, but they require a signed attestation from the property owner and amended diagrams delivered within seven days.

How long does a termite treatment take?

A conventional liquid treatment on a residential slab is usually a day, sometimes less, depending on the linear footage and how much drilling is involved through patios, porches, sidewalks and attached slabs. Bait system installation is faster to place and slower to work, because the point is for the colony to find and share the material. We will tell you which one you are getting and roughly how long before you should expect to see a change.
